Abstract

Digital transformation has become a strategic necessity in modern public administration, not merely as a technological innovation but also as an instrument of governance reform. Batu City, with its tourism- and agriculture-based economy, faces diverse and complex demands for public services. The local government has responded by developing several applications, such as Lapor Batu, Among Batu, e-Puskesmas, and Batu Among Tani Teknologi (BATT). Nevertheless, the implementation of these digital services remains constrained by limited ICT infrastructure, low levels of digital literacy, weak inter-agency system integration, and inadequate bureaucratic capacity. This study aims to describe the implementation of digital transformation in Batu City and to analyze its contribution to the realization of adaptive and responsive governance. The research employs a qualitative descriptive approach using literature review and document analysis, with data drawn from government policy documents, SPBE reports, scholarly publications, and national surveys. The findings reveal that digital innovations in Batu City have expanded into the areas of complaints management, licensing, healthcare, education, and cultural services, yet they remain at an early stage with limited effectiveness. The conclusion highlights that digital transformation in Batu City holds potential as a foundation for adaptive and responsive governance, but requires stronger system integration, institutional capacity, and citizen participation to achieve inclusive and sustainable benefits.
